Chivalry 2 Has Sold Over 1 Million Units

Since its launch in June, Torn Banner Studios' medieval PvP combat game has sold over a million copies, with players collectively having logged over 8 million hours of play time.

Torn Banner Studios’ medieval multiplayer action title Chivalry 2 launched a little over two months ago, and unsurprisingly, it’s done pretty well for itself since then. The first game was quite successful, and there’d been quite a bit of excitement for the sequel, so it’s not entirely surprising. Even so, it’s been announced via a press release that Chivalry 2 has sold over a million copies since its launch.

It’s getting pretty good engagement numbers as well, apparently. According to stats released by Torn Banner and publisher Tripwire Interactive, Chivalry 2’s player base has collectively played the game for over 8 million hours, during which time they’ve all killed over 420 million knights in battle. The Messer is apparently the most popular weapon in the game, too.

“We are so happy to have brought Chivalry 2’s unique experience of bloody, epic medieval warfare to so many people – and we’re already hard at work expanding the game much, much more,” said Torn Banner president Steve Piggott.

Tripwire Interactive CEO John Gibson added: “We’ve been blown away by the response from players and critics alike, and the team is already hard at work on more great free content and adding highly requested features such as cross-platform parties.”
